Burner Caps and Heads
Before removing the burner caps and heads (on some
models), remember their size and location. Replace them
in the same location after cleaning.
NOTE: Do not use steel wool or scouring powders to
clean the burner parts.
Burner caps
Lift off when cool. Wash burner caps in hot,
soapy water and rinse with clean water. You may
scour with a plastic scouring pad to remove
burned-on food particles.
Burner Bases (on some models)
The round burner bases are not removable. Only the caps
may be removed for cleaning.
To clean the burner bases, use soapy water and
a plastic scouring pad. Wipe clean with a damp
cloth.
Make sure that no water gets into the burner
bases. Allow them to dry fully before using.
Burner Heads (on some models) and Oval (Center)
Burner Head/Cap Assembly
The burner heads and the oval burner head/cap assembly
are removable. Simply lift them off the range for cleaning.
For proper ignition, make sure the small hole
in the section that fits over the electrode is kept
open. A sewing needle or wire twist-tie works
well to unclog it.
The slits in the burner heads must be kept clean at all
times for an even, unhampered flame.
Clogged or dirty burner ports or electrodes will
not allow the burner to operate properly.
Any spill on or around an electrode must
be carefully cleaned. Take care to not hit an
electrode with anything hard or it could be
damaged.
Clean the burner heads routinely, especially after
bad spillovers, which could clog the openings.
Lift off when cool.
To remove burned-on food, soak the burner
heads in a solution of mild liquid detergent and
hot water for 2030 minutes. For more stubborn
stains, use a toothbrush.
After cleaning
Before putting the burner caps, heads
(on some models) and oval head/cap assembly
back, shake out excess water and then dry them
thoroughly by setting in a warm oven for 30
minutes.
Replacement
Burner Heads
(on some models)
Replace burner heads over the electrodes on
the cooktop, in the correct locations according
to their size. There is one small, one medium,
one large and one extra large burner head.
Make sure the slot in the burner head is
positioned over the electrode.
Oval (Center) Burner Head/Cap Assembly
Replace the oval (center) head/cap assembly
over the electrode on the cooktop.
Caps
Replace the matching size caps onto the burner
bases or heads.
Make sure that the heads (on some models) and
caps are replaced in the correct locations.
